Web1 dag geleden · The Short Answer: The trade winds are winds that reliably blow east to west just north and south of the equator. The winds help ships travel west, and they can also steer storms such as hurricanes, too. It generally confines itself to a relatively narrow … WebThere are two prominent jet streams in the Northern Hemisphere. The Subtropical Jet Stream, which in the summer is located at about 40° N and in winter at about 30° N in approx. 12-16 km's height, and the Polar Jet stream, which normally lies between 50° N and 70°N at approx. 7-10 km's height. Web3 jul. 2011 · The northern hemisphere polar jet stream is most commonly found between latitudes 30°N and 60°N, while the northern subtropical jet stream located close to latitude 30°N.
